Rated
5.0 out of
5 from
1Reviews
Red Lobster
is a highly reviewed Seafood Restaurant Restaurant
Ranked #1 of 22 Restaurants in Merrillville.
Some say it is great.
★★★★★ on the 7th of August, 2013
Sam Adams Winter Lager goes great with the fried shrimp.